We put MS SQL in full recovery mode, then have a maintenance schedule in MS
SQL that does a full back-up. We exclude the actual data files and include
the log files (full and transaction). We have the schedule run about 15 min
before bacula runs on the client. I think the RunBefore Client would be a
better option though.
